The Early Supports for Infants and Toddler (ESIT) Referral /Access to Baby and Child Dentistry (ABCD) Coordinator's overall responsibility is to assist families to receive coordinated, responsive, timely ESIT and ABCD referrals in accordance with contractual timelines and requirements. Assures that families who have children with disabilities or developmental delays receive quality family resource coordination in accordance with their rights and procedural safeguards under Part C of the Individuals with Disabilities Education Act (IDEA).
This position provides program coordination for implementation of the Access to Baby and Child Dentistry (ABCD) Program. They work with the dental community, ARCORA foundation, and other healthcare providers and community partners to increase the understanding of the importance of oral health and its impact on overall population health and collaborate with the ABCD Dentist Champion to recruit and train ABCD providers.
Some Essential Functions Include:
- Processes ESIT and ABCD referrals, ensuring timeliness, family choice, and program standards.
- Communicates with families to obtain needed information, explain ESIT/ABCD eligibility, and determine provider preferences.
- Serves as the primary point of contact for referral sources (hospitals, medical providers, social service agencies) and maintains those relationships.
- Assigns Family Resource Coordinators (FRCs) in the ESIT Data Management System and ensures timely communication to contracted ESIT providers.
